Obverse descriptionLaure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Gordian III, right, seen from rear
Obverse script
Obverse letteringΑΥΤ Κ Μ ΑΝΤ ΓΟΡΔΙΑΝΟϹ
(Translation: Emperor Caesar Marcus Antonius Gordianus)
Reverse descriptionDionysus standing left, holding long thyrsus and cantharus; behind, Pan standing left, holding pedum
Reverse script
Reverse letteringΕΠ ΓΡ ΑΜΑΡΑΝΤΟΥ ΜΑΓΝΗΤΩΝ
(Translation: under the grammateus Amarantos, of the Magnesians)
